Genesis GV80 Window Tinting: When a Re-Application is Necessary
Even a luxury SUV like the Genesis GV80 can benefit from a window tinting upgrade. This review details a re-application for a GV80 owner who experienced significant discomfort with their original tint. The previous film was excessively dark, severely impairing visibility during nighttime driving and leading to increased eye strain and stress for the driver. This highlights a crucial point: window tinting is not just about aesthetics or UV protection; it directly impacts driving safety and comfort. An overly dark tint can be more dangerous than no tint at all. Fortunately, the owner was a repeat customer and trusted their local installer for a solution.
Choosing SolarGarde Quantum for Enhanced Visibility and Protection
The owner opted for SolarGarde Quantum film, a premium option manufactured using a full metal sputtering process. This advanced method results in exceptional clarity and a sharp, clear view, setting it apart from conventional films. A key benefit is the significantly reduced driver fatigue, especially during night drives. To address the visibility issues of the previous tint, the owner selected specific darkness levels: 19% for the front windshield, 14% for the front side windows, and 8% for the rear. While these are darker than the typically recommended percentages for the front (around 28%), the owner's confidence in the Quantum film's superior clarity allowed for this bolder choice.
The Re-Application Process for the Genesis GV80
The Genesis GV80 in question was only about a month old when the re-application was requested. This meant the original film was relatively easy to remove, with minimal adhesive residue left behind. This clean removal is essential for a flawless new tint installation. The process involved carefully stripping the old film and preparing the glass surfaces to ensure optimal adhesion for the new SolarGarde Quantum film. Applying this type of metal-sputtered film requires a high level of skill and precision due to its complexity, but the installer's expertise ensured a high-quality finish.
Installation process:
- Old Film Removal: Carefully peel off the existing window tint film without damaging the glass or leaving behind adhesive residue.

- Film Application: Precisely cut and apply the new SolarGarde Quantum film to the prepared glass, using specialized tools to eliminate air bubbles and ensure a smooth finish.
- Curing: Allow the film to cure properly, which typically takes a few days, during which time the windows should not be rolled down.
After installation, the 19% tint on the front windshield provides excellent privacy from the outside while maintaining a clear, unobstructed view for the driver. The 14% tint on the front sides and 8% on the rear further enhance privacy for rear passengers. The SolarGarde Quantum film offers a subtle color variation depending on the darkness: the 14% tint has a slight yellowish hue, while the 8% tint leans towards blue, adding a touch of luxury to the vehicle's appearance. This re-application successfully addressed the driver's concerns, providing a safer, more comfortable, and visually appealing driving experience.

Q. How long does window tint last on a Genesis GV80?
High-quality window tints like ceramic or metal-sputtered films can last 10-15 years or even longer with proper care. To maintain your tint, avoid rolling down windows for the first few days after installation and clean them using ammonia-free glass cleaners and a soft microfiber cloth.
Q. Is ceramic tint worth the extra cost for a Genesis GV80?
Ceramic tint is often worth the investment for a Genesis GV80 if your priority is maximum heat rejection and UV protection without compromising visibility. It offers superior performance compared to dyed or metallic tints, justifying the higher window cost for enhanced comfort and protection.
Q. How is window tint installed on a Genesis GV80?
Window tint installation involves cleaning the glass thoroughly, precisely cutting the film to match the window shape, and applying it using a squeegee to remove air bubbles and ensure a smooth finish. The process requires skill to achieve a bubble-free, durable application.
Q. What is the difference between ceramic and dyed window tint for a Genesis GV80?
Ceramic tint uses non-conductive ceramic particles for excellent heat rejection and UV protection, offering superior durability and clarity. Dyed tint uses coloring agents that can fade over time and offers less heat rejection, making ceramic tint a better long-term investment for your Genesis GV80.
